Shimmer & Shine: Mastering Gold Embossing Powder
Achieving that breathtaking gold embossed effect can seem daunting, but with a little practice, it's remarkably easy to learn. Here's guide explores the critical techniques for working with gilt embossing more info powder, covering everything from choosing the right ink and stamping powder to troubleshooting common problems. A spotless work surface and careful approach are key; bear in mind that static can be your adversary, so addressing it with an anti-static tool beforehand is a fantastic idea. Furthermore, experiment with different heat settings on your embossing gun to find what works finest for your specific powder and project – too much warming can cause pitting, while too little will result in an incomplete raised design. Delving into Beyond the Basics: Advanced Relief printing Techniques
Once you've mastered the elementary principles of relief work, a whole realm of creative possibilities opens up! Advanced techniques allow for far more intricate imagery than simple stamps can provide. Consider layered embossing, where multiple plates are used to create depth and dimension, or negative embossing, which involves sinking areas instead of raising them – producing a strikingly unique textural impact. Bespoke tools, like hand-carved dies or precise etching methods, become essential for achieving these finer results. Furthermore, playing with with different surfaces—like reflective foil or see-through acetate—can greatly enhance the final creation. Learning to combine these innovative approaches requires experience and a willingness to push the edges of traditional relief printing!
